Eustace Miles

Eustace Hamilton Miles was an English real tennis player, author, and restaurateur, known for his contributions to health and nutrition during the Edwardian era. He gained recognition not only for his athletic prowess, competing in the 1908 Summer Olympics, but also for his advocacy of vegetarianism, a lifestyle he embraced while expressing a distaste for the label itself. Miles became a prominent figure in promoting health products and advice, tapping into the growing interest in health and wellness among the British public at the time. In addition to his athletic career, Miles authored several works that reflected his passion for health and nutrition. His writings often emphasized the importance of a balanced diet and physical fitness, positioning him as a forward-thinking voice in the early 20th century health movement. His influence extended beyond the realm of sports, as he contributed to the broader discourse on healthy living, making him a notable figure in both the sporting and literary communities of his time. Miles's legacy endures through his pioneering efforts in promoting a healthy lifestyle, which laid the groundwork for future discussions on nutrition and wellness.
